HL Deb 16 November 2004 vol 666 c129WA
Lord Jacobs

asked the Chairman of Committees:

Why Questions for Written Answer tabled in this Parliamentary Session and answered after the end of the Session will not be printed in the Official Report, given that such Questions are on public record. [HL4973]

The Chairman of Committees (Lord Brabazon of Tara)

Prorogation puts an end to all business before the House, with limited exceptions which do not include Questions for Written Answer. Where a Question for Written Answer has not been answered at the end of a Session, it can be retabled at the start of the new Session to ensure that the Answer will appear in theOfficial Report.
